Carl Queck Obituary

Published by Legacy Remembers on Sep. 19, 2017.

Carl Robert Queck, age 96, passed away peacefully on September 16, 2017. He was the loving husband of the late Wanda Mae, father of Jody (Jay) Ferry, grandfather of Cindy (Dave) Schmuck, Josephine Ferry, Heather Cerone, Jamie (Norma) Ferry and Jessica (Addison) Whitworth and brother of Helia Ball. He was preceded in death by his son Carl William Queck.

Carl enjoyed dancing, golfing and playing pool. He was Mr. social, liked being active and liked helping people. Carl was a member of the Michigan Builders Association and was President of the Michigan Kiwanis Club. He retired from his position as an Engineer from General Motors. Carl spent his retirement in Florida before moving back to be with his loving daughter Jody in recent years. He will be greatly missed.

Services were private.
